Abstract
Domingo Fontán Rodríguez, catedrático de matemáticas sublimes de la Universidad de Santiago de Compostela y autor de la Carta Geométrica de Galicia, es una de las personalidades históricas de la Galicia del siglo XIX que se han dedicado a la ciencia y al desarrollo económico de su tierra. Aunque ya se han escrito relevantes biografías y trabajos sobre su figura, en el presente artículo se pretende profundizar en el reconocimiento que tuvo en la capital de la Corte y también fuera de las fronteras españolas.
Domingo Fontán Rodríguez, professor of sublime mathematics at the University of Santiago de Compostela and author of the Geometric Chart of Galicia, is one of the historical personalities of the 19th century in Galicia who has dedicated to science and the economic development of their land. Although relevant biographies and works have already been written on his figure, this article aims to deepen the recognition that he had in the capital of the Court and also outside the Spanish borders.
